Included

One-piece sleeve with construction guides

The export contains a complete symmetrical sleeve piece with sleeve-cap and underarm seams, grainline, bicep and elbow guides, hem line, selected allowances, notches, and a 5 × 5 cm print test square.

Measurements

Arm length, bicep, wrist, elbow and cap height

Arm length and wrist set the lower sleeve; bicep plus ease controls upper-arm room. Elbow length positions the guide, while cap height controls the height and curvature of the sleeve head.

Options

Long, relaxed, short or cap sleeve

Presets provide practical starting values for length, ease, and cap shape. Each measurement remains editable, so the sleeve is recalculated instead of scaled from a fixed-size pattern.
